strindl;560780 Wrote:
I just got my Touch today and that VU meter thing looks pretty cool on
the transporter and older SB units. HOw do I enable it on the Touch?
It's enabled already. There are five different Now Playing screens -
you just need to cycle through them by either touching the
JJZolx;560784 Wrote:
It's enabled already. There are five different Now Playing screens -
you just need to cycle through them by either touching the middle of
the screen or pressing Now Playing on the remote (you'll get the larger
sized font versions of the screens if you use the remote).
